AS far checking the head for warpage you can use a flat edge and a flash light, but a rule of thumb is anytime you take the head off to replace a headgasket is to have it cleaned and shaved. you can take it to Hendrix in Locust Grove 770-954-0301 He has done many of my heads and does good work from what I have used him for.

Break in, well lets put it this way I always drive gentle for the first oil change and they re check the torque specs and then I roll on them. But that is just me because I am pickie on everything .Also Get new Head bolts on that car
